SENATE RESOLUTION NO. 462
         WHEREAS, U.S. Navy Petty Officer Simon Urbanic rendered
  exceptional service to his country as a member of the USS Vulcan
  crew during the Cuban Missile Crisis in 1962; and
         WHEREAS, A native of Galveston, Mr. Urbanic served as an
  opticalman petty officer 3rd class on the USS Vulcan; his
  responsibilities aboard the ship included repairing binoculars,
  telescopes, and such navigation equipment as sextants and
  azimuth bearing circles; and
         WHEREAS, In fall 1962, Petty Officer Urbanic had been
  aboard the vessel for six weeks before the October outbreak of
  the Cuban Missile Crisis, a major confrontation that brought the
  United States and the Soviet Union dangerously close to war over
  the presence of Soviet nuclear-armed ballistic missiles on the
  island of Cuba; on October 22, President John F. Kennedy ordered
  a naval quarantine in an effort to keep Soviet ships from
  delivering more weapons to Cuba; the Vulcan was deployed to San
  Juan, Puerto Rico, where Petty Officer Urbanic and his crewmates
  provided essential repair, electronics, and support services to
  the American ships forming a quarantine ring blockade around
  Cuba; the strategy proved successful, and the Vulcan returned
  home to Norfolk, Virginia, on November 30, following its 23-day
  mission in the Caribbean; and
         WHEREAS, Years later, Petty Officer Urbanic was honored
  during a ceremony in League City, where he was presented with the
  Texas Cold War Medal and the National Defense Service Medal, as
  well as the Armed Forces Expeditionary Medal, which recognized
  his participation in the Cuban blockade; and
